Alexandra, has been alone ever since her parents disappeared on her 12th birthday. Her quiet, lonely life is interrupted when Her Royal Highness Sileena Sporthood's soldiers come knocking on her body. She is taken to the Fortress where she discovers the preserved bodies of all Sileena's enemies lining the halls and is thrust into a rebellion... ****Irregular updates!***

Book one of "What is Bought in Blood Must be Repaid" duology When a father dies, the family weeps. When a King dies, the kingdom wails. Alula, the Crown Princess of Alethium, led her entire life thinking that she would inherit the throne at her father's passing. At a year after The King died tragically in battle, her mother refuses to abdicate the throne. Under the new Queen, Alethium and its various statehoods are suffering, displacing citizens as surrounding countries encroach their borders. Alula must make her mother see reason, or see her mother overturned. The Queen of Alethium has different plans for her daughter. Alula will join this year's social season to find a husband, and the next King will be born of Alula's womb. There is a problem with this plan; not only does Alula not want to marry, but she happens to kill anyone who touches her bare skin. A life sequestered in the castle with a deadly power that cannot be revealed has left Alula fearing human connection, and placed upon the marriage market will only make her goal of changing Alethium for the better all the more difficult. Alula's life only looks grim until her mother makes the dire mistake of assigning her a personal guard- Tall, freckled, and handsome, Terran Juliano.
